Pre-Shipping Vehicle Inspection
The first step in preparing your car for shipping is to conduct a thorough inspection. This involves checking the overall condition of your vehicle, including the tires, brakes, fluids, and any existing damage or issues. It’s important to document the current state of your car by taking clear, detailed photos from multiple angles.
During the inspection, be sure to:
- Check the tire pressure and ensure all tires are in good condition
- Inspect the brakes and ensure they are functioning properly
- Top off all fluids, including oil, coolant, and windshield wiper fluid
- Note any existing dents, scratches, or other damage on the exterior and interior
Documenting the condition of your car before shipping is crucial, as it will help you identify any potential issues that may arise during transport and ensure you’re covered by the carrier’s insurance policy.
Cleaning and Documentation
Once you’ve completed the pre-shipping inspection, it’s time to clean your car both inside and out. This not only enhances the appearance of your vehicle but also makes it easier for the transport carrier to conduct their own inspection upon pickup.
During the cleaning process, be sure to:
- Wash the exterior of your car, paying special attention to the wheels and undercarriage
- Vacuum the interior and remove any personal belongings or loose items
- Take clear, high-quality photos of the car’s interior and exterior
In addition to the cleaning and documentation, you’ll also need to gather the necessary paperwork for your vehicle, including the registration, title, and proof of ownership. These documents should be kept in a safe, easily accessible location during the shipping process.
Removing Personal Items
Before your car is loaded onto the transport carrier, it’s important to remove any personal items or valuables from the interior. This includes items such as:
- Loose change, cash, or other valuables
- Aftermarket accessories or modifications
- Child seats, pet carriers, or other loose items
By removing these items, you’ll not only protect your belongings but also make the loading and unloading process easier for the transport carrier.
Mechanical Preparation
In addition to the exterior and interior preparation, there are a few mechanical tasks you’ll need to complete before your car is ready for shipping:
- Ensure the gas tank is no more than one-quarter full
- Disable the alarm system and deactivate the remote start feature
- Disconnect the battery and secure the negative terminal
These steps help to minimize the risk of any issues during transport and ensure the safety of the carrier and your vehicle.
Day of Pickup Checklist
On the day of pickup, there are a few final items you’ll need to address before your car is loaded onto the transport carrier:
- Conduct a final inspection and take additional photos
- Provide the transport carrier with a copy of the vehicle’s registration and title
- Review and sign the Bill of Lading, which outlines the terms and conditions of the shipment
- Confirm the delivery address and provide any necessary contact information
By completing this checklist, you’ll ensure a smooth and seamless pickup process, allowing the transport carrier to safely load your vehicle and begin the journey to its destination.
What to Do at Delivery
When your car arrives at its destination, it’s important to follow these steps to ensure a successful delivery:
- Inspect the vehicle thoroughly upon delivery, checking for any new damage or issues
- Document any concerns by taking clear photos and notifying the transport carrier immediately
- Sign the Bill of Lading, indicating that you’ve received the vehicle in satisfactory condition
- Provide the carrier with any necessary information, such as the delivery address or contact details
By following these steps, you’ll be able to address any issues that may have arisen during the shipping process and ensure that your car is delivered to you in the same condition as when it was picked up.
